热门问题
时间线
聊天
视角

Redox

以Rust編寫的作業系統 来自维基百科,自由的百科全书

Redox
Remove ads

Redox是用Rust語言寫就的類Unix微內核操作系統。Redox追求可用性、自由和安全性,目標是把Rust語言的創新(安全、並發、實用)帶入到現代的微內核和整套的應用程序。[5]

事实速览 開發者, 編程語言 ...
Remove ads

支持

目前Redox支持[6]:

  • 所有x86_64架構CPU
  • 有VBE支持的所有顯卡
  • AHCI協議的硬盤
  • E1000或RTL8168網卡
  • PS/2模擬接口的鼠標和鍵盤

設計

Redox為了實現它的目標,它有以下的一些設計決定:

  • 使用Rust編程語言
  • 使用微內核設計,類似於MINIX
  • 包含可選的GUI界面 - Orbital
  • 支持Rust標準庫
  • 使用MIT許可證
  • 驅動運行在用戶空間
  • 包括常見的Unix命令
  • 包含C程序的新移植庫

歷史

Redox最早於2015年4月20日在Github上發表。[7]從此開始了活躍的開發進程。

參見

參考文獻

Loading related searches...

Wikiwand - on

Seamless Wikipedia browsing. On steroids.

Remove ads